      <title>VCA yellow in SIM, but green in SMH when using reference psp</title>
      <link>https://community.hpe.com/t5/server-management-systems/vca-yellow-in-sim-but-green-in-smh-when-using-reference-psp/m-p/5059798#M49165</link>
      <description>Hi. I have two issues with SIM and VCA (see screenshot):&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;1. Why is SIM displaying the server's SW status as yellow (minor) when it's local SMH-&amp;gt;VCA is reporting it as green (normal)?&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Doesn't SIM respect my choice of a reference support pack? Mine is 7.80, but as you know there are a couple of "minor" releases/updates since 7.80. Is that why SIM is reporting minor status?&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;2. Why is SIM reporting some server's SW status as "Unknown - VC agent not configured"? &l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Again, if I check the server's local SMH-&amp;gt;VCA, it's nice and green, and getting repository info from the VCRM on the SIM server.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Thanks in advance! &l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;/Anders (day 4 of SIM implementation now) :)</description>

      <description>The SW flag is updated by the Software Version Status Polling task which I think runs weekly.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;If you've made changes you can manually run the task which should update the SW flags.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;VC Agent not configured would indicate that the VCA has not been configured correctly or cannot access the VCRM.</description>

      <description>Ah. Running the task manually solved both my problems. I also scheduled that task to run nightly instead of weekly.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Many thanks for the fast and correct response!</description>
